A must-have for walkways AND driveways
This is a very well designed tool, and it's helping me get much more mileage out of my salt supply (which is being consumed by this New England winter we're having).When I first read that it holds 10 lbs. of salt, I thought that was not enough, but I was wrong -- it's just the right amount. That weight lets you shake and spread the salt easily.In the past, anything I tried (including flinging the salt by hand) proved to be inaccurate and wasteful. I'd get little piles of salt right next to bare spots. And I'd end up using way more than was necessary (basically, just from putting down too much trying to cover the bare spots).With this, I get a very even spread very easily from the start, and every pound of salt is obviously a) covering more square feet than before and b) leaving no bare spots.This is particularly important for my 50 foot driveway. It's packed gravel, which "eats" salt much faster than pavement. If I can't get the right spread much of my salt will be wasted, then I'll run out, Home Depot won't have any left, etc. I've found that, if I just focus on the two tire tracks, I can get the driveway done with this device in about 15 minutes, and it takes me about seven or eight refills at most (about two 40 lb. bags) to get a nice, dense coating that cuts through the snow and ice and keeps working for days on the gravel. Very gratifying!My only concern: the top is hinged on two sides (with a split down in the middle of the top) and the "hinges" are actually just molded plastic. So, you're bending plastic over and over again each time you open it and I wonder how long that will last. But I've opened it dozens of times with no actual signs of wear, so I'm not going to worry about it.Simple, reliable device that just works and is very easy to use.

Lol...used this all winter and forgot to review it
We had a lot of snow this winter and a lot of days where it snowed, then was warm, and then freezing cold again.....making for a lot of slippery ice. This little item really helped ALOT with spreading salt evenly. Spreading the salt evenly with something like this makes it a lot more effective than simply throwing handfuls of it. What happens when you throw it randomly is it tends to clump together unevenly. Some areas have too much salt and others not enough. You get stubborn patches of unmelted ice plus salt piles people step in and drag into the house. This device solves that problem cheaply and efficiently. It's very good and spreading the salt evenly...which is a lot more effective and the salt goes further when you have to cover large areas. I found it especially effective with calcium salt (which is expensive but worth it), particularly on thick, hard to remove patches of ice. I actually purchased a propane ice melter this year and didn't use it once because this cheap device was so effective with the salt.
